Cost-Effectiveness Comparison



When contrasting the cost-effectiveness of solar energy with typical power resources, it comes to be apparent that initial financial investment distinctions play an essential function in establishing long-lasting savings.

While solar power systems need a greater in advance investment for installment and tools, they offer considerable long-term benefits that can surpass the first prices. The key lies in understanding that solar power systems have very little ongoing operational and maintenance expenses compared to traditional energy resources like nonrenewable fuel sources.

By buying solar power, you can possibly save on utility costs over the system's lifespan. Furthermore, with advancements in modern technology and decreasing installment costs, solar energy has become extra obtainable and inexpensive for house owners and services alike. These savings can build up with time, supplying a return on investment that goes beyond typical energy resources.



In addition, solar power systems provide the advantage of power freedom and stability against fluctuating utility rates. By utilizing the power of the sunlight, you add to a cleaner atmosphere and lower your carbon footprint. Embracing solar power not just benefits your budget however also the world in the long run.

Environmental Impact Analysis



Solar power presents an appealing alternative to traditional power sources because of its dramatically lower ecological effect. Unlike fossil fuels that discharge hazardous greenhouse gases and add to air contamination, solar power creates power without generating any exhausts.

The process of utilizing solar power involves recording sunlight through solar panels, which does not release any toxins into the environment. This lack of emissions helps reduce the carbon impact related to energy manufacturing, making solar power a cleaner and a lot more lasting option.

In addition, using solar energy contributes to conservation efforts by lowering the need for limited sources like coal, oil, and natural gas. By relying upon solar energy installations and renewable resource resource, we can help preserve natural habitats, secure ecological communities, and mitigate the adverse effects of source extraction.

Integrity and Energy Landscape Analysis



For an extensive assessment of reliability and the energy landscape, it's important to examine exactly how solar energy compares to typical sources. Solar energy is making headway as a reputable and sustainable energy resource. While standard sources like coal, oil, and natural gas have been historically leading, they're limited and contribute to environmental destruction.

Solar energy, on the other hand, is bountiful and eco-friendly, making it a much more lasting option in the future.

In terms of integrity, solar power can be depending on climate condition and sunlight schedule. Nevertheless, improvements in technology have actually caused the development of energy storage space services like batteries, boosting the reliability of solar power systems. Conventional sources, however, are at risk to cost variations, geopolitical tensions, and supply chain disruptions, making them much less trustworthy in the long-term.

When analyzing the energy landscape, solar energy supplies decentralized power production, minimizing transmission losses and enhancing power safety and security. Traditional sources, with their central power plants, are much more vulnerable to interruptions and require extensive framework for circulation.
